Background
River channel dredging generally refers to treatment of river channels and belongs to hydraulic engineering. The method comprises the steps of blowing and stirring sludge deposited at the bottom of a river into a turbid water shape through mechanical equipment, and enabling the sludge to flow away along with river water, so that a dredging effect is achieved, riverway siltation increasingly affects normal play of various functions such as flood control, waterlogging drainage, irrigation, water supply, navigation and the like, and in order to recover the normal functions of the riverway and promote rapid and continuous development of the economic society, riverway dredging engineering is carried out, so that the riverway is deepened and widened through treatment, river water becomes clear, the production conditions and living environment of the masses are obviously improved, and the aims of 'water cleaning, river smoothness, green bank and beautiful scene' are achieved.
At present, in order to guarantee the ecological environment in river course, need clear up dumped river course, clear up out the silt in the river course, nevertheless clear up river course silt at present, generally be by the silt extraction in suction dredge pump with the river course, because the workload of suction dredge extraction is big, lead to silt water content more easily, the numerous degree can influence silt cleaning effect, consequently, need use a kind of silt descaling machine for dumped river course, can separate the silt and the water of extraction.

In one aspect of the present embodiment, after the small electric push rod 20 is started, the small electric push rod can drive the supporting leg 21 to ascend and descend, so that the supporting leg 21 can support and fix the sludge cleaning machine.
In an aspect of this embodiment, the staff can remove regulation with cleaning tank 2 through the rotation of handle 19 cooperation universal wheel 18, makes things convenient for this silt descaling machine, can clear up the silt of the extraction of different positions.
In one aspect of this embodiment, the gasket may promote the seal between the baffle 8 and the screen 4 after the baffle 8 is pressed against the surface of the screen 4.
In one aspect of this embodiment, the operator can observe the sludge and water separation within the cleaning tank 2 through the observation window 22.
In an aspect of this embodiment, after the third electric putter 14 starts, can drive the push pedal 15 and remove the regulation to can promote the silt after the separation on the filter screen 4, conveniently clear up the silt after the separation.
